POPLAR BLUFF, Mo. -- City phone lines are down in Poplar Bluff. 

The city's police department took to  to let the community know of the ongoing issue. The post said that all administrative phone lines in the city are experiencing the technical difficulties. 

Police believe the issue tracks to an issue with the VOIP carrier. They say the problem is intermittent. 

911 lines are still operational for emergencies. For non-emergency issues that require urgent assistance, the police ask residents to call 573 718-0235.

The department says it will post an update when phone lines return to normal.
